About the OPPORTUNITY
We have a great opportunity for a Training Lead - Maritime, to join our Maritime Australia business on the Hunter Class Frigate Program based at either Osborne, Adelaide or Melbourne CBD location. This key technical training position will report to the Training Manager, and will be offered on a permanent full time basis.
We embrace flexible work arrangements at BAE Systems Australia, including working a 9-day fortnight and hybrid working.
BAE Systems Maritime Australia (formerly known as ASC Shipbuilding), has been contracted to design and deliver the world’s most advanced anti-submarine warfare frigates to the Royal Australian Navy. The Hunter Class Frigate Program (HCFP) will create and sustain more than 5,000 jobs across BAE Systems and the wider Australian Defence supply chain over the life of the program.
Key responsibilities include:
- Provide leadership to the training team who analyse, design and develop training requirements for Navy personnel
- Provide leadership to the training team who develop and assure the recommended crewing solution for the Hunter Class Frigate.
- Provide leadership to the training team, coach and develop personnel, ensuring services provided meet business and customer objectives
- Provide support to the ILS Maintenance Requirements Determination (MRD) team in undertaking Operating Task Analysis and the development of evolutions matrix activities
- Support the identification and documentation of training equipment requirements to support the training of Navy personnel and teams
- Oversee the assessment for the feasibility of the delivery of training for whole of ship activities, including the training design curriculum to support training for whole of ship activities
- Lead the training team in the development of training and assessment materials for whole of ship related activities and support the customer’s assessment of those training activities
- Establish effective consultation and communication mechanisms with customers, internal and external stakeholders, ensuring that stakeholders are fully engaged, establishing good relationships
- Drive culture of training design and training development best practice, efficiency and continuous improvement
About YOU
- Defence Maritime experience and experience operating equipment on naval ships
- People leadership experience with a demonstrated ability to manage a team and provide effective leadership, direction and motivation
- Good communication and stakeholder management skills, good computer skills and proficiency with using the Microsoft Office Suite
- Whilst not essential, technical training experience or a relevant training qualification, will be highly regarded
